How it feels
A young woman in Tehran faces difficult choices about her future. Her personal desires clash with the rigid expectations of her family and society.

What happens
Dead End (Persian: Bon Bast) is a 1977 Iranian drama film written and directed by Parviz Sayyad. It was entered into the 10th Moscow International Film Festival where Mary Apick won the award for Best Actress. (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
